The GSI high current RFQ prototype

  • 1. Inst. fuer Angewandte Physik, J.W. Goethe Univ. Frankfurt (Germany)

Description

A new high current injector (HSI) for the UNILAC and the SIS synchrotron for all ions up to uranium is planned at GSI. The spiral-RFQ accelerator accepts low energy (2.2 keV/u), high current (25 mA) beams at low charge states (U2+) at an operating frequency of 27.1 MHz. Results of particle dynamics calculations and structure development for the first crucial part of the HSI-RFQ where all the bunch forming is done, is presented together with results of rf measurements and first beam tests.
